HOT NEW SLOTS PAY OUT MORE THAN OLD ONES
Players rush to the latest slot terbaru thinking it’s “due” for big wins. They assume casinos program new games to pay out more at launch to attract players. Wrong. Every slot has a fixed return-to-player (RTP) percentage set by the provider, not the casino. A 96% RTP slot stays 96% whether it’s day one or day 100.
Casinos don’t need to rig new slots. The hype does the work for them. Players flood in, and the house edge grinds them down over time. The RTP is baked into the math model before the game even hits the floor. Check the game’s info screen—if it says 94%, it’s 94% on release and forever.
Play the RTP, not the release date. A two-year-old slot with 97% RTP beats a brand-new 94% slot every time.

BIGGER JACKPOTS MEAN BIGGER CHANCES TO WIN
Progressive jackpots on slot terbaru dazzle with seven-figure numbers. Players assume the bigger the jackpot, the higher their odds of hitting it. Reality: the opposite is true. Progressives grow because no one wins them. The odds of hitting a $1 million jackpot might be 1 in 5 million, while a $10,000 jackpot could be 1 in 500,000.
The math is brutal. A $1 million jackpot with 1 in 5 million odds means you’re 10 times less likely to win than a $10,000 jackpot with 1 in 500,000 odds. The house edge on progressives is often higher too—sometimes 10% or more. That’s why casinos push them so hard.
Target fixed jackpots or low-variance slots if you want consistent wins. Save progressives for occasional fun, not strategy.

VOLATILITY DOESN’T MATTER IF YOU’RE PATIENT
Players pick high-volatility slot terbaru thinking, “I’ll just bet small and wait for the big win.” They ignore volatility because they believe patience alone beats the math. Volatility isn’t about time—it’s about risk. High-volatility slots pay out less frequently but with bigger wins. Low-volatility slots pay out often but with smaller wins.
Here’s the catch: high volatility drains your bankroll faster. A $100 session on a high-volatility slot might last 20 spins, while the same session on a low-volatility slot could last 200 spins. The RTP is the same, but the risk of ruin is 10 times higher.
Match volatility to your bankroll. If you have $50, don’t touch a slot with $10 spins. Play low or medium volatility until you can afford the swings.
